I haven't run mine for autox yet... historically the answer for autox is as much as you can get though assuming top tier tires are used.

For open track, in my non-R I've been up to -3.9 and as low as -2.5 and will be starting 2020 season with -3.2 as I'm trying some diff tires and adding diff springs/sways than stock so kinda starting over again....

prob not that useful, but it's a starting point!

yeah as follow up, it took a camber bolt AND the oem 2019 camber plates to get to -3.9...
Doing it with the bolts changes the virtual pivot point relative to the overall KPI angle. Plates + opening the tower hole is the way to go for getting large camber.

I thought front toe is usually slightly negative/out for track alignments. So that turn in is easier. Ford Performance specs slightly positive/in toe up front.

Anyone else think that's strange?

I'm trying -.05 on each side on Friday at Summit Point Main Circuit.
